Mumbai, April 9 -- Stryder Cycle, a Tata Enterprise and a trusted name in Indian cycling, has broadened its electric vehicle lineup by introducing two new e-bikes called Airborne and Arcus. These models are crafted for modern city life, blending smart technology, reliable performance and real-world usability to make ecofriendly travel more attainable.

As urban traffic worsens and awareness of sustainable transport grows, Stryder keeps pushing clean mobility solutions that are efficient, stylish and well suited for Indian roads. The Airborne model targets adventure seekers with rugged power and all terrain handling.
